Dr Haskins is a South African trained nurse and the Chief Nursing Officer (CNO) at Sheikh Khalifa Medical City since June 2023. She has 26 years’ experience in United Arab Emirates, which includes:
  • 1997 – Nurse Manager in a Paediatric and Immunization Outpatient Clinic.
  • 1999 – Joined Ministry Of  Health – Manager Operating Room and Surgical Units Central Hospital/ and was promoted to Assistant Director of Nursing in Central and Al Jaziera Hospital, 2002
  • 2004 Al Jaziera and Central Hospitals merged with SKMC and was promoted as Assistant Director of Nursing until May 2018.
  • August 2018 joined private hospital in Sharjah /Dubai as Assistant / and Director of Nursing.
Dr Linda has 19 years’ experience in direct patient care including various leadership roles in South Africa in following clinical settings: Emergency Medicine, Surgical Units, Operating Room Nursing, Community Health and Intensive Care nursing.
